Product Description

It is December, and Stinky and friends hit on the idea of inviting everyone they know to the House of Fun for Christmas. Since the Spoonheads have sucked up all the adults into their space zoo, the three friends are free to have the craziest party the world has ever seen. They invite all their friends. At this point the Brain Drain arrives. Created by the Spoonheads, the Brain Drain is rather like a Blood Bank, except it siphons out a small (unimportant) portion of each donor's brain in order to revitalize Blue Soup. This is the first time since the Spoonheads' departure that the Brain Drain has visited. Icky, Stinky, and Bryan all give brains. The next day, replies start arriving from their invitations. They are delighted until they realize they can no longer remember what Christmas is. The Brain Drain has evidently malfunctioned.
